2. Service Description

Migration Accelerator is a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) platform that helps organizations migrate content from various Content Management Systems (CMS) to Magnolia CMS using artificial intelligence, automation tools, and content mapping capabilities.

2.1 Key Features

  • AI-powered content analysis and mapping
  • Automated content migration from multiple CMS platforms
  • Template and component configuration tools
  • Screenshot capture and visual analysis
  • Migration progress tracking and reporting
  • Team collaboration and organization management
  • Integration with Magnolia CMS and other platforms

9. AI Services and Accuracy Disclaimer

9.1 AI-Powered Features

Our Service uses artificial intelligence to analyze content, suggest mappings, and automate migration processes. AI-generated results are provided as suggestions and recommendations only.

9.2 Accuracy Disclaimer

IMPORTANT: AI analysis and suggestions are not guaranteed to be accurate, complete, or suitable for your specific needs. You must review, verify, and approve all AI-generated content mappings before executing migrations.

9.3 User Responsibility

You acknowledge and agree that:

  • AI suggestions require human review and approval
  • You are responsible for verifying the accuracy of migration results
  • We are not liable for errors or omissions in AI-generated content
  • Final migration decisions and execution are your responsibility
  • You should test migrations thoroughly before production deployment

9.4 Continuous Improvement

We continuously work to improve our AI algorithms, but perfection cannot be guaranteed. AI performance may vary based on content type, complexity, and source system characteristics.

16. Dispute Resolution

16.1 Informal Resolution

Before initiating formal dispute resolution, we encourage you to contact us at legal@noice.net.auto seek informal resolution of any dispute.

16.2 Mediation

If informal resolution is unsuccessful, disputes shall first be submitted to mediation under the rules of the Australian Centre for International Commercial Arbitration (ACICA) or another mutually agreed mediation service.

16.3 Arbitration

If mediation fails, disputes shall be resolved through binding arbitration administered by ACICA under its arbitration rules. The arbitration shall be conducted in Melbourne, Australia, in the English language.

16.4 Exceptions

The following disputes are exempt from arbitration: (i) intellectual property infringement claims, (ii) claims for injunctive relief, and (iii) small claims court matters within jurisdictional limits.
